We stayed at the Elizabeth in London about 3 weeks ago. On the plus side it provided protection from the elements. The location was nice, about a five minute walk from Victoria station which made our departure via Gatwick very easy (you cancheck your luggage at Victoria straight through to your destination on British Air). The staff at the Elizabeth were not rude but seemed totally disinterested. Breakfast was barely palatable, not up to the usual standard of the "full English breakfast". The room was adeguate in size and beds were ok, floors a little creaky. Altogether, I would go back only if I couldn't find similar, conveniently located hotel.

I stayed at the Melia White House in London last November. It was very nice, clean and in a very good location near busses, subway and walking distance to quite a bit. Our package included a buffet breakfast that was really very good. Our room was rather on the small side - but we didn't really mind as we didn't spend a lot of time there. My sister and her husband had one of their renovated rooms and it was a lot nicer than ours. Maybe you could ask for one of those. I would definitely stay there again.
